Output 74527763c7a0602b38cca40ce4b15d4da6ea90d086ef761b3bb78f6536c85273:4

value
3966083
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 014c02dfec71e5418ca11554ccc263ac478b73b9 OP_EQUALVERIFY OP_CHECKSIG
address
17rjYb8zaC5w3YjLw38dzen52T5pvf6xE
transaction
74527763c7a0602b38cca40ce4b15d4da6ea90d086ef761b3bb78f6536c85273
confirmations
229273
spent
true